Additional Info
  • Public transportation options are available nearby
  • Travelers should have at least a moderate level of physical fitness
  • Minimum age is 8 years old
  • Vegetarian option is available, please advise at time of booking if required
  • Operates in all weather conditions, please dress appropriately
  • This is a moderate hike at altitude that many guests may find challenging. This tour is not recommended for people who do not regularly exercise. Out of respect for the other guests on the tour, please consider our Rocky Mountain National Park sightseeing tour if you are unsure if you can meet the physical requirements. Our guides reserve the right to ask guests to stop or turn around on the hike.
  • We cannot guarantee a specific trail - we chose based on day, condition, crowds.
  • From November to April, waterproof shoes are highly recommended. Wool socks are also recommended.
  • Winter weather conditions may exist in the park, please dress adequately for potentially snowy conditions and low temperatures.
